I'm sure the views >>>>differ on that position but maybe Theron agrees with Gian-Carlo that this >>>>specific position is an artificial one. >>>> >>>>regards Joachim >>> >>>this position is a question of search not tuning... >> >>I think that GCP talked about tuning the >>extension and pruning rules. >> >>I can imagine that a change in the pruning rules that is productive for other >>positions is not productive for this position. >> >>I do not believe that it is impossible to fix the problem in a productive way >>and I guess that the real reason is that in the same time of fixing the program >>it is possible to do bigger improvements. > >I don't think that solving this position is a matter of pruning or extensions, >since Comet could solve it on a 16 MHz 80386 in a few seconds. It only proves that it is a matter of pruning because Comet had not the same pruning that tiger or sjeng had. I guess that GCP can easily change Sjeng not to have the pruning rules that it has in order to solve it but the problem is that sjeng is going to be weaker only in other pawn endgames. I do not know but I guess that the pruning is about pruning lines that lose a lot of tempos. Uri
